W.S. Kimball & Co.

Charles Wood, Champion Jockey of England, from the Champions of Games and Sports series (N184, Type 2) issued by W.S. Kimball & Co.

1887
Commercial color lithograph
6.8 × 3.8 cm (2.7 × 1.5 in)
